Preview: West Ham United vs. Liverpool

West Ham vs. Liverpool

West Ham United host Liverpool at Upton Park this Sunday with three points separating them in the Premier League table.

The Hammers currently sit in eighth in the standings, while Liverpool reside three places below their London competitors as they head into the weekend's meeting.

Sam Allardyce's men can put pressure on the top five if they manage to claim a victory on home turf and the Reds could move into the top eight if they snatch a win without star striker Luis Suarez.

Liverpool boss Brendan Rodgers will be forced to line up without the inspirational Uruguayan, who was suspended after picking up his fourth yellow card of the season in the Reds' 1-0 win over Southampton last weekend, which means that Jonjo Shelvey could be pushed up into a forward role.

Meanwhile, Allardyce is likely to opt for Carlton Cole up front with Mohamed Diame and Mark Noble operating the midfield.
